Wisconsin Senate Proposes Strict KYC Rules for Bitcoin ATMs

A new bill from the Wisconsin Senate could significantly alter how Bitcoin ATMs operate within the state. The proposed legislation mandates full Know Your Customer (KYC) verification on all transactions, requiring customers to present photo ID for every purchase, regardless of the amount. Additionally, a daily transaction cap of $1,000 per person is proposed along with extensive data collection by operators. These measures aim to combat fraud, money laundering, and other illicit activities related to cryptocurrencies.
